My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:


Hi my name is Zeppelin!
I am a one-year-old, 60 pound, male GSD who is neutered and up-to-date on all my shots! I was surrendered to Tacoma-Pierce Humane Society in October of 2025. My new owners adopted me in November of 2025 and I have been loving life ever since! I absolutely love playing fetch with tennis balls and will run around all day. I get along with other dogs in dog parks and in my own home! I currently live with a 3-year-old female GSD and we play around all the time. I give out lots of kisses and want to snuggle/get pets 24/7. I do well in the crate when my owners leave for work during the day, but definitely need to expend that energy once I am let out.

Owners Note:
Zeppelin has been an absolutely amazing dog for my wife and I ever since we adopted him. Unfortunately he had a small behavior mis-hap which resulted in him biting a maintenance worker in our complex. Our landlord has told us we need to get rid of him ASAP, and his chances at any shelter are grim.
